build bot (Jenkins) has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/32220 )
Change subject: Add empty stubs for KASAN to coreboot. Kconfig default settings set to compile with KASAN. ......................................................................
Patch Set 1:
(16 comments)
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c File src/lib/kasan.c:
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@16 PS1, Line 16: void __asan_loadN_noabort(unsigned long addr,size_t); space required after that ',' (ctx:VxV)
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@16 PS1, Line 16: void __asan_loadN_noabort(unsigned long addr,size_t); function definition argument 'size_t' should also have an identifier name
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@17 PS1, Line 17: void __asan_storeN_noabort(unsigned long addr,size_t); space required after that ',' (ctx:VxV)
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@17 PS1, Line 17: void __asan_storeN_noabort(unsigned long addr,size_t); function definition argument 'size_t' should also have an identifier name
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@21 PS1, Line 21: void __asan_load1_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@22 PS1, Line 22: void __asan_store1_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@23 PS1, Line 23: void __asan_load2_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@24 PS1, Line 24: void __asan_store2_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@25 PS1, Line 25: void __asan_load4_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@26 PS1, Line 26: void __asan_store4_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@27 PS1, Line 27: void __asan_store8_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@28 PS1, Line 28: void __asan_load8_noabort(unsigned long addr){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@29 PS1, Line 29: void __asan_loadN_noabort(unsigned long addr,size_t i){ } space required after that ',' (ctx:VxV)
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@29 PS1, Line 29: void __asan_loadN_noabort(unsigned long addr,size_t i){ } space required before the open brace '{'
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@30 PS1, Line 30: void __asan_storeN_noabort(unsigned long addr,size_t i){ } space required after that ',' (ctx:VxV)
https://review.coreboot.org/#/c/32220/1/src/lib/kasan.c@30 PS1, Line 30: void __asan_storeN_noabort(unsigned long addr,size_t i){ } space required before the open brace '{'